FG06 ZVL is a 2006 Volkswagen Beetle in Silver with a 1,596cc petrol engine. This vehicle has been through 32 MOT tests with a personal pass rate of 56.3%.
Across all 2006 Volkswagen Beetle models, the average MOT pass rate is 72.5% with a typical mileage of 67,762 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Volkswagen Beetle f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 44,561 recorded failures. If you're considering buying FG06 ZVL, it's worth having these areas checked by a mechanic before committing.
The Volkswagen Beetle typically stays on UK roads for around 56 years. At 20 years old, this Volkswagen Beetle is still in the earlier part of its expected life.
